In San Diego County, there are four Superior Court judicial seats on the ballot for the 2024 primary election. With just two attorneys vying for each of the two contested seats, the winners will secure the simple majority needed to be elected and serve on the bench. Among the candidates is Jodi Cleesattle, a seasoned attorney running for Seat 41 against Brian Erickson.
